Oxygen can bond with many compounds including itself (O3-ozone) it is very reactive; other compounds are:

CO2- Carbon Doixide

H2O- Water

N2O- Nitrous Oxide (laughing gas)

H2SO4- Hydrogen Sulfate

SiO2- Silicon Dioxide (quartz)
